1. The potential nitrous oxide emissions in a permanent grassland chronosequence
Kandidat-uppsats, SLU/Dept. of Forest Mycology and Plant PathologySammanfattning : As a part of a larger project (Belowground biodiversity of grasslands – conservation needs and potential to promote sustainable agriculture), this study aims to investigate potential nitrous oxide (N2O) emissions and microbial gene abundances needed for the production (nirS and nirK) and reduction (nosZI and nosZII) of nitrous oxide in soil of permanent grasslands of various age. Thegrasslands have at different times been converted to permanent grasslands and are of interest because of the possibility to shed more light about the passage of time’s affects on the soil microbialcommunities and their activity. 4. Imputing connections of random gene networks from time series data using ANNs
Master-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Beräkningsbiologi och biologisk fysik - Genomgår omorganisationSammanfattning : This thesis presents the architecture of a convolutional neural network which is trained to impute the connections of randomly generated gene regulatory networks under varying amounts of regularisation. The generated gene networks are simulated from 10 different starting conditions for each set of connections in order to obtain multiple time series. LÄS MER
